One of the companies driving this revolution is Geely Group’s Zeekr brand, which makes many high-tech EVs like the 001 crossover, 007 sedan and 009 MPV. Zeekr also happens to be a battery and charging behemoth.

Many of its EVs ride on the Sustainable Experience Architecture (SEA)—also shared by other Geely Group brands like Volvo and Polestar—and it claims to have developed the world’s fastest-charging EV battery. Zeekr claims its Golden battery supports a 5.5 C-rate, meaning it can charge or discharge at 5.5 times its total capacity per hour. At a rate of 1C, for example, a battery would charge in one hour. A rate of 2C would halve that time to 30 minutes. A Tesla Model S briefly charged at a peak of 2.5C in one of our tests, for reference.

The Golden Battery is a big leap. Zeekr says it can charge from 10-80% in just 10.5 minutes.
